Committee formed to organize Mahashivaratri at Pashupatinath Temple



KATHMANDU: A 201-member celebration committee has been formed under the coordination of Minister for Culture, Tourism, and Civil Aviation Badri Prasad Pandey to oversee the preparations for the Mahashivaratri festival in the Pashupatinath area.

The committee was established during a meeting of the council chaired by Minister Pandey, who also serves as the chairman of the Pashupati Area Development Trust Board of Directors.

Additionally, nine thematic sub-committees have been formed under the main committee to facilitate various aspects of the festival’s organization.

According to Dr Milan Kumar Thapa, member secretary of the trust, preparations have already begun, including painting, mural artwork, and lighting management in the Pashupati area.

This year’s Mahashivaratri festival falls on February 26, and thousands of devotees are expected to gather for the grand celebrations.
